Queerphoria is a moving, joyous and celebratory show where LGBTQIA+ icons share their stories of becoming. In each episode we meet queer trailblazers - including Graham Norton, Layton Williams, Jayde Adams and Harriet Rose - and discover the life defining moments that gave them a sense of queer euphoria.
Lessons for everyone through a queer lens: from iconic culture shifting events, to personal eureka moments, this is where we come together as a community to share the stories that made us.

Which three queer landmarks has British Vogue columnist Raven Smith chosen as his queerphoric moments? Join host Jack Guinness as he takes a deep-dive into Raven's cultural pond (apologies if that sounds gross).
His first book Raven Smith’s Trivial Pursuits, was a Sunday Times best seller. His second book, the brilliant Raven Smith's Men was described as "Wise, sharp and naughty" by The Observer and published in 2022. Raven is one of Jack's favourite human beings- you may know him for his hilarious Instagram account, but today you get to meet the man behind the memes…
Raven Smith has been 32 for several years and lives in London with his husband and cat.
